Up until now, the scoop has been that if K gets 90% and goes to court to force acquisition of remaining ARU shares, the shareholders can make representations to the judge that a higher price is warranted. This seems to be plausible for without this possibility, what is the point of a court hearing? The forcing would appear to be a cut and dried matter at that stage, if no increase in price can be sought.

Could you confirm that your literal wording is the law, or is it possible we could still petition for a higher price, with justification provided, of course? This is of some significance, I believe.
